[QUOTE=/Vandy/;36295577][B][I][U]Scott's Wishlist of Airsoft[/U][/I][/B] (Not country oriented) -WE or WA 1911A1 -CYMA RPK -Trishot for shits and giggles[/QUOTE] Do not buy WE. WA is good but expensive, and I'm fairly certain they can't run green gas/propane. Get TM, or save a lot of money while retaining performance and cool by getting a KJW which can take anything (some even CO2) and works very well. If you go the route of an RPK/any SAW, be prepared to offer up your firstborn in exchange for BBs. Also, for the sake of science do some upgrades to it so it shoots straighter, as accuracy AND volume would be quite nice. Tri-shots are cool. Word of warning, it could be just me, but it seems difficult to aim with the stockless model. It has more maneuverability but it seems necessary to aim very much straighter as opposed to a rifle, because there's no way to brace yourself for sight alignment like you would with a rifle. It could've also been because .25s were giving me tighter groupings, or a combination of the above, but it was just too easy to miss as opposed to a pistol or a rife which have very natural aiming properties. I'm seriously considering tacticooling mine using Ender's guide, would recommend you do the same just because.
